Tips
Milly could further explore her understanding of geography by engaging in hands-on activities such as mapping her own neighborhood or conducting a small project on how local wetlands are maintained. Additionally, researching more global sites can enhance her view of different cultures and geographical features across the world. Engaging with more interactive educational videos on diverse geographical topics may also prompt deeper learning and curiosity.
Book Recommendations
- The Magic School Bus: Inside the Earth by Joanna Cole: Join Ms. Frizzle and her students on a journey through the layers of the Earth, exploring geological features and natural wonders.
- National Geographic Kids: Everything Geography by National Geographic Kids: A vibrant book filled with fun facts and illustrations that teach children about different geographical features and locations around the globe.
- Maps by Aleksandra Mizielinska & Daniel Mizielinski: A beautifully illustrated book that introduces young readers to countries around the world, showcasing maps filled with unique cultural details and natural features.
